How they compare

Estonia currently reports 3.33 billion current US$ against 2.83 billion current US$ in Niger, a difference of 498.65 million current US$.

That makes Estonia's figure about 1.2 times Niger's.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Estonia ahead.

Estonia ranks 91st and Niger ranks 93rd of 150 countries.

Estonia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
